Once you put the firewire card in, you just plug one end of the cable to the card and the other to the camcorder's firewire port and then you need software to capture the video. Any of the video editing software programs that I will discuss below will capture video or as noted in the link directly above, that firewire card comes with software. You probably have a program that came with your computer as well.
The other way to capture video (and you would only want to do it this way if you had an analog camcorder rather than digital) is through your computer’s video card and it would have to be a card that has that capability (most of them do). However, if you capture video through your video card, you will lose some quality because you will be “truly capturing” through an analog device. With a digital camcorder, the firewire card doesn't actually "capture" in that sense, it simply transfers the digital file from your camcorder to the computer with zero loss of quality. So if you want excellent quality, I would highly recommend buying a digital camcorder if you do not already have one.
I should also mention that video files are huge—about 1 Gigabyte for every 4 minutes of DV AVI (that’s the format most of the popular smaller digital camcorders use now and it is compressed AVI). What you should do to avoid dropping frames when you capture (you don’t want to drop frames because it reduces the quality) is have a separate hard drive that is dedicated just to video editing. That separate hard drive should be at least 60 Gigabytes—I recommend 120 Gigs or more. And hard drives are very cheap now. They are a bit more tricky to install so unless you are good with computers, I would recommend getting help in the hardware forum or again, having someone else install a separate hard drive in your computer. You don’t need that, but it really helps to reduce the loss of frames when capturing.

Step 2--Encode the movie to MPEG-1 (VCD) or MPEG-2 (DVD format)

There are two types of hardware devices that burn to discs—either a CD burner or a DVD burner. With the first, you must burn in “VCD” (Video CD) format. That is not as good quality as a DVD and some DVD players will not play VCDs. I recommend that you use a DVD burner—if you do not have one, (you can get them for $100 or so now and they are pretty easy to install in your computer (just pull out the CD burner and connect the same cables to the DVD burner and if you are using Windows 2000 or XP, it should be no problem being recognized automatically). But again, you could buy it at a computer store and have them install it for you.
The "encoding" is what is done to the AVI file to make it compatible for burning to a VCD or DVD. The DV AVI is "encoded" (compressed even more than DV AVI) to MPEG-1 (VCD) or MPEG-2 (DVD) format. Good programs for encoding to MPEG are:

All of the above are very good quality--TEMPenc Express has the best user interface and easiest to understand, but it is the slowest of the three. Cinemacraft is probably the best quality result, but the other two are very close.
You take the DV AVI file you just created with Screenblast (i.e., your finished movie) and use one of the above programs to "encode" it to VCD or DVD format (i.e., MPEG-1 or MPEG-2). There are basically two formats that have to do with television standards in countries. Most of you will use "NTSC" and should choose that standard to encode your video. Step 3--Create DVD menus and burn the DVD
Finally, you need what is called a DVD authoring program. That program is what you use to take movies you've encoded and then create nice menus like on commercial DVDs. For example, you might make three different movies on Screenblast, then encode them to three separate MPEG files, then use the DVD authoring program to create a menu that appears on the DVD to then select which movie you want to watch and burn all three to the one DVD. So your finished DVD starts with a first menu allowing you to select however many movies you've put on that DVD. This is good because DVDs are large (4.7 Gigs) and most people make shorter vinets of their home movies rather than long marathons that can get boring (not to mention how large the file would get). So I recommend making smaller movies up to about 20 minutes maximum. You might, for example, burn 5 to 10 smaller movies on one DVD using a DVD authoring program to burn them all in one shot and create menus to select them (typically you can get about 60 plus minutes on a standard one-sided DVD). You can even create chapter markers to move around in the video just like in DVDs you rent.

Now keep in mind that you don't actually need all these programs, but you will find that the movie production programs such as Screenblast do not do as good a job at encoding to MPEG format as the programs I listed, so you get better quality movies using a good encoder. And Screenblast (or other movie production program) typically does not do DVD authoring (which allows you to create menus. If you want, you could just take the DV AVI file from your camcorder and capture the video directly into Ulead DVD Movie Factory and it would also encode it and burn it directly to DVD (in that case, that is the only program you would need). But again, Movie Factory is not as good an MPEG encoder and you cannot do many of the editing things you can do with Screenblast.
